class IntegerStoppingCriteria(StoppingCriteria):
def __init__(
self,
tokenizer: PreTrainedTokenizer,
prompt_length: int,
max_digits: int = 15,
):
self.tokenizer = tokenizer
self.prompt_length = prompt_length
self.max_digits = max_digits
def __call__(
self,
input_ids: torch.LongTensor,
scores: torch.FloatTensor,
) -> bool:
decoded = self.tokenizer.decode(
input_ids[0][self.prompt_length :], skip_special_tokens=True
)
if len(decoded.strip()) > self.max_digits:
return True
if (
len(decoded) > 1
and any(c.isdigit() for c in decoded)
and decoded[-1] in [" ", "\n"]
):
return True
return False
class OutputIntegersTokens(LogitsWarper):
def __init__(self, tokenizer: PreTrainedTokenizer, prompt: str):
self.tokenizer = tokenizer
self.tokenized_prompt = tokenizer(prompt, return_tensors="pt")
vocab_size = len(tokenizer)
self.allowed_mask = torch.zeros(vocab_size, dtype=torch.bool)
for _, token_id in tokenizer.get_vocab().items():
token_str = tokenizer.decode(token_id).strip()
if token_str == "" or all(c.isdigit() for c in token_str):
self.allowed_mask[token_id] = True
def __call__(self, _, scores):
mask = self.allowed_mask.expand_as(scores)
scores[~mask] = -float("inf")
return scores

def generate_integer(self, temperature: Union[float, None] = None, iterations=0):
prompt = self.get_prompt()
self.debug("[generate_number]", prompt, is_prompt=True)
input_tokens = self.tokenizer.encode(prompt, return_tensors="pt").to(
self.model.device
)
response = self.model.generate(
input_tokens,
max_new_tokens=self.max_number_tokens,
num_return_sequences=1,
logits_processor=[self.integer_logit_processor],
stopping_criteria=[
IntegerStoppingCriteria(self.tokenizer, len(input_tokens[0]))
],
temperature=temperature or self.temperature,
pad_token_id=self.tokenizer.eos_token_id,
)
response = self.tokenizer.decode(response[0], skip_special_tokens=True)
response = response[len(prompt) :]
response = response.strip()
self.debug("[generate_integer]", response)
try:
return int(response)
except ValueError:
if iterations > 3:
raise ValueError("Failed to generate a valid integer")
return self.generate_integer(temperature=self.temperature * 1.3)
